As part of the preparation for a celebration honoring the 30th anniversary of the start of diplomatic relations between Egypt and Belarus in 2022, the embassy of Belarus held a press conference to commemorate the anniversary and exchanged views with members of the Egyptian media and tourism sector officials.

The conference focused on enhancing cooperation and fostering bilateral relations between the two countries in areas of tourism, education, and trade alongside sharing experiences on counter-terrorism; theoretical and practical assistance in terms of combating terrorist activities.

During this conference, the Ambassador of Belarus to Cairo Terentiev highlighted his country’s intense and constructive bilateral relations with Egypt, referring to the positive roles played by President El Sisi and Egyptian officials in the Middle East as having been instrumental in the steady improvements of political, economic, and social standards in the country.

“We also appreciated his role in the establishment of regional cooperation frameworks such as his latest initiatives and proactive stances in promoting an inclusive dialogue with a view to reconciling perse viewpoints and taking further concrete action to strengthen those alliances,” Terentiev pointed out.

The ambassador also said: "Egypt's development approach sets a model for other countries."

On the other hand, Hany Said, an Egyptian official, revealed that Belarus tourism to Egypt has steadily boomed in recent years, adding that “Egypt has received nearly half a million tourists.”
